LSVIUCV will loop if presented with a SYS hold file in its reader. The
reason for this is what I call a lack of consistence in CP. When you have only
USER held files in your reader, a TIO on the virtual reader returns a nonzero
CC, meaning that the reader has no file to process. Now if you have a file in
SYS hold, you get CC=0 which is I think stupid because not only won't you be
able to pull anything out of your virtual reader, but you won't even be able
to change the file to NOSYS if you're not priv'ed.
Anyway this will be fixed in 1.5l
